Transaction 5688f3b126673f171990480c157d2df3bfe7c29dea0615a89ae947ad1b586ccf
1 Input
1 Output
-
5688f3b126673f171990480c157d2df3bfe7c29dea0615a89ae947ad1b586ccf:0
- value
- 66138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 834597ab274374caf5ebd71ec9a3b21b731b7a83 OP_EQUAL
- address
- 3Df7p3PtzTepqTowpdtHVZHY7tMN8SSPix